Key Terminology
-
Ton-force (short)/sq. foot
-
A non-SI unit of pressure equal to one short ton-force applied over one square foot, used mainly in engineering contexts.
-
Attopascal [aPa]
-
An SI derived unit of pressure equal to 10^-18 pascal, used to measure exceptionally small pressures.
-
Pressure
-
The force applied perpendicular to the surface of an object per unit area.
